Driven by rising home automation trends and heightened awareness around indoor air quality, the Fan Speed App fills a practical need: giving users precise control and visibility over fan operations without technical expertise. Its appeal lies in simplicity—monitoring speed, tracking performance trends, and optimizing settings to suit personal comfort—all from a clean, mobile-friendly interface.

How does it work? The app integrates with compatible smart fans, drawing live data on rotational speed, airflow intensity, and energy consumption. Users view real-time metrics and historical patterns through intuitive visual dashboards, enabling proactive adjustments. This transparency builds trust by empowering informed decisions, especially during seasonal changes or when improving home environment conditions.

Despite its utility, common questions arise. Why track fan speed at all? The answer lies in efficiency—optimized airflow reduces energy waste while maintaining comfort. Users report noticeable improvements in seasonal comfort, especially in climates with fluctuating temperatures or humidity. Concerns about data privacy and app accuracy are addressed through secure, encrypted connections and transparent data handling practices.

While not a replacement for specialized HVAC tools, the Fan Speed App serves as a user-friendly bridge between casual tech adoption and deeper environmental control. It fits seamlessly into broader home optimization trends without overpromising—focused instead on practical, manageable improvements.
